您现在的位置是:首页 > 问答 > 

肿么读取Android的蓝牙接收到的数据

2025-07-25 23:20:11
首先,在使用蓝牙进行数据传输时,需要确保手机的蓝牙功能已经打开。一般来说,安卓系统下的蓝牙默认为打开状态,除非之前进行过配对操作。然而,有些设备可能无法接收或发送特定格式的数据,例如apk格式。在这种情况下,可以在发送数据之前添加".MP"后缀,确保数据以MP格式传输。接收端收到数据后,则需要去除".MP"后缀使其恢复为原始的apk格式以便进行安装。值得注意的是,并非所有设备都能够正确解析和
首先,在使用蓝牙进行数据传输时,需要确保手机的蓝牙功能已经打开。一般来说,安卓系统下的蓝牙默认为打开状态,除非之前进行过配对操作。
然而,有些设备可能无法接收或发送特定格式的数据,例如apk格式。在这种情况下,可以在发送数据之前添加".MP"后缀,确保数据以MP格式传输。接收端收到数据后,则需要去除".MP"后缀使其恢复为原始的apk格式以便进行安装。
值得注意的是,并非所有设备都能够正确解析和安装.apk文件,因此在使用蓝牙传输.apk文件时需要确保目标设备支持安装.apk文件,并且具有相应的权限。
总结起来,在使用蓝牙进行数据传输时需要确保手机的蓝牙功能处于可用状态,并根据具体情况调整文件的格式以适应接收方设备。同时还要注意目标设备是否支持所需文件类型及权限等相关要求。 |||android 蓝牙编程的基本步骤:

1.获取蓝牙适配器bluetoothadapter blueadapter=bluetoothadapter.getdefaultadapter();

如果bluetoothadapter 为null,说明android手机没有蓝牙模块。

判断蓝牙模块是否开启,blueadapter.isenabled() true表示已经开启,false表示蓝牙并没启用。

2.启动配置蓝牙可见模式,即进入可配对模式intent in=new intent(bluetoothadapter.action_request_discoverable);

in.putextra(_discoverable_duration, 200);

startactivity(in); ,200就表示200秒。

.获取蓝牙适配器中已经配对的设备setdevice=blueadapter.getbondeddevices(); 4.还需要在androidmanifest.xml中声明蓝牙的权限 接下来就是根据自己的需求对bluetoothadapter 的操作了。 |||太专业鸟

#感谢您对电脑配置推荐网 - 最新i3 i5 i7组装电脑配置单推荐报价格的认可,转载请说明来源于"电脑配置推荐网 - 最新i3 i5 i7组装电脑配置单推荐报价格

本文地址:http://www.dnpztj.cn/ask/1193707.html

相关标签:无
上传时间: 2025-07-23 03:19:56
留言与评论(共有 12 条评论)
本站网友 牌照识别
26分钟前 发表
有些设备可能无法接收或发送特定格式的数据
本站网友 肺结核的症状
24分钟前 发表
即进入可配对模式intent in=new intent(bluetoothadapter.action_request_discoverable); in.putextra(_discoverable_duration
本站网友 美国减税
2分钟前 发表
说明android手机没有蓝牙模块
本站网友 中国电信上海
30分钟前 发表
安卓系统下的蓝牙默认为打开状态
本站网友 人民广场二手房
4分钟前 发表
|||android 蓝牙编程的基本步骤:1.获取蓝牙适配器bluetoothadapter blueadapter=bluetoothadapter.getdefaultadapter(); 如果bluetoothadapter 为null
本站网友 预售房
18分钟前 发表
值得注意的是
本站网友 做梦找不到回家的路
24分钟前 发表
接收端收到数据后
本站网友 vc片的作用和功效
20分钟前 发表
在使用蓝牙进行数据传输时
本站网友 脑电波控制
4分钟前 发表
并根据具体情况调整文件的格式以适应接收方设备
本站网友 海口滨江帝景
14分钟前 发表
值得注意的是
本站网友 手机报在线
30分钟前 发表
200); startactivity(in);